Off-site run checklist — item 7. Crate of survey instruments (levels, two theodolite heads, tripod clamps) for the Brackwell ridge job. Heads up: the foam inserts shifted last time, so repack with the instruments lens-down and wedge the spare padding from bay 3. Crate stays sealed once Petra signs the contents slip — no opening at the gate, even if the site crew asks. Weight is about 40 kilos, so use the trolley. The courier hand-over instruction for this crate is:

drop instructions, bagag-kafof: the ulaion wenax courier leaves the aldeth ledger at gate 6755 under passcode 507500

// Tilewarden prefetcher client setup.
// Pulls map tiles from the internal Cartolane cache ahead of
// customer navigation sessions so first paint stays under 200ms.
// Prefetch radius defaults to three zoom levels around the last
// viewport; adjust via PREFETCH_DEPTH if support tickets mention
// blank tiles. Requests hit the Cartolane edge only, never the
// public map vendor. The client authenticates with the internal
// service key that follows.

app token of bawep-hafog = kto7_vwrmnlx

Headline: 18-month exclusivity, 12% revenue share, quarterly true-up. Exposure capped at the committed marketing spend; no minimum purchase clause, which is favourable. Flags: currency adjustment mechanism is one-sided, and the termination-for-convenience window is too short at 30 days. Recommend counter on both before signature. Legal has seen v3; finance sign-off pending the counters. Wider context on why this partnership matters is summarised below.

confidential, kagup-bafog: Fraaxax Group is in early talks to buy Soroxox Group for about $343.8 million. The Olidor launch date is June 14, and nothing goes to the press before then. Legal wants the Aldmirek Logistics term sheet signed before July 23.

## Authentication

Welcome to the Duskpanel admin dashboard. Dark-mode preferences are stored server-side per operator account, so theme state survives across devices — which means every theme read and write goes through the authenticated settings API, not local storage. New team members should note that the theme endpoint requires the same scopes as profile editing. For local development, start the mock identity service and use the bearer token below.

login token, bagug-kafop: eyJhbGciOiJIUzI1NiIsInR5cCI6IkpXVCJ9.eyJzdWIiOiIcMLov2In0.Z5RLDIfp